The latest weekly ETF fund flow data shows that market capital is becoming clearly polarized.📊
This week, Bitcoin spot ETFs recorded a net outflow of $389.71 million, and Ethereum spot ETFs also saw a net outflow of $2.26 million.
But on the other side, Solana spot ETFs recorded a net inflow of $10.26 million, and XRP spot ETFs also attracted $2.25 million in funds—now that’s interesting.👀

If capital were simply leaving the crypto market, then SOL and XRP should, in theory, also face net outflows. But the situation right now is this: as BTC and ETH holdings decrease, some capital starts flowing to other assets.

Does this mean institutional capital is re-seeking opportunities?🔎
The next thing most worth watching is whether the inflows into SOL and XRP can be sustained.
If BTC and ETH continue to bleed out while SOL and XRP keep attracting capital, then the market’s capital preference may be quietly shifting.

But if BTC capital returns in the future, then this capital divergence may just be a short-term phenomenon.
